Job Description

YOUR ROLE



This position will be part of the Child Safety and Risk Directorate within MACS and be responsible for the triage of complex cases submitted to the Complex Cases Team, management of complex cases, and management and response to complaints escalated to the Executive Director.



This position will also be responsible for reviewing and refining complaints management policy, assisting with quarterly reporting to the MACS Board, and projects for the purpose of building consistent complaints management activities across MACS. In carrying out this role, the Complex Case Advisor will demonstrate a commitment to the mission of Catholic education and promote strong, shared leadership, creativity, and innovative practice.



WHAT YOU WILL DO




Work with internal stakeholders and coordinate all internal communications, to assist in appropriate and consistent management of complex issues.

Review and refine MACS complaints management policies and Complaints and Complex Issues Management (CIM) framework for continuous improvement.

Collaborate with internal and external stakeholders to ensure consistent and effective complaint resolution.

Track, analyze, and report on complaint data to identify trends and areas for process enhancement.

Support capability development by building awareness and providing guidance on CIM policies across MACS.

Manage escalated and high-risk complaints, ensuring compliance with governance and regulatory requirements.



ABOUT YOU




A relevant tertiary qualification in a related discipline (e.g., Legal) and experience in complaints management or handling complex issues.

Strong understanding of the legal and regulatory framework applicable to schools in Victoria.

Experience in developing, applying, and refining complaints management policies, frameworks, and processes.

Excellent interpersonal and communication skills to work effectively with internal and external stakeholders.

Strong analytical and problem-solving abilities, with a commitment to procedural fairness and natural justice.

Ability to work autonomously and collaboratively, demonstrating integrity, respect, and excellence in line with Catholic education values.
